Output 628f409680902e526fce718665552adad9959cc5a7012421014c0c04ecf8b8ef:6

value
224475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aadcc5036d29829bc0a4685e2d4eab78bc726634 OP_EQUAL
address
3HGTGVdmeuQ3ebHNEq93DXPq6KopQ5zCcC
transaction
628f409680902e526fce718665552adad9959cc5a7012421014c0c04ecf8b8ef
spent
true